Should you even negotiate over this issue? With this party? Now? Bingham presents a pragmatic overview of when negotiation might logically be avoided, and when, particularly in multiparty or dispute systems design, you might need to think strategically about unintended "chilling." This essay is closely linked to Blum's & Mnookin's on the principles of "not negotiating," and to Morash's, whose discussion of "nonevents" is one form of the systemic chilling that Bingham discusses here.
